Output 361d305db1f23e963957a741770ebfb242132ad2a091a013a51622e8e93848f6:0

value
32140506399
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ac731e4a03ed96a596313acddaf15f28f4b3ba60 OP_EQUAL
address
3HQr46irvZo1urrvvCuaofsgMVrv7Vxu7D
transaction
361d305db1f23e963957a741770ebfb242132ad2a091a013a51622e8e93848f6
spent
true